Bachelor of Engineering Technology in Civil Engineering
Offered by Durban University of Technology
Minimum APS
28
Qualification
degree
Duration
3 years
Faculty
Faculty of Engineering and the Built Environment
Subject Prerequisites
Mathematics
NSC Level 5+
Physical Sciences
NSC Level 4+
English
NSC Level 4+
Career Paths
Civil engineers are in demand for SA's infrastructure projects. ECSA registration boosts career prospects.
› Civil Engineer
› Structural Engineer
› Construction Manager
› Transport Engineer
› Water Resource Engineer
› Quantity Surveyor
Salary Expectations (South Africa)
Starting Salary
R22,000 – R30,000
Mid-Career Salary
R50,000 – R90,000
Salary estimates based on South African job market data (2024-2026). Actual salaries vary by employer, location, and experience.
